Basic Metal Finishing - Most of the time, metal finishing is required for a pleasing appearance and clean-room application. It really is one of the more widely used practices because of its utility in intensifying the overall beauty of the product, such as, motorbike parts, cookware or automobile parts. Moreover, a large number of clean-rooms desire a burnished finish to decrease the permeability of the material which might result in dust to gather and contaminate. A really good instance of this usage would be in vacuum chambers.

There exist a great many ways to polish metals, and we'll consider the various techniques required. Metals can be burnished electromechanically, chemically, manually, or with purpose made buffing machines. A special finishing compound or paste is commonly used, which may include ch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its rather high viscosity is amongst the time intensive. On the other side, products made from non-ferrous metals are certainly more responsive to polishing, because these call for the least amount of treatments.

A slower pad speed is commonly used any time a superior mirror finish is crucial. Polishing buffs smothered in paste can be greatly impacted by the pressures on the surface of the pad. The concentration of the surface pressure might be amplified within certain levels, but exceeding the ideal degree of force not only decreases the quality level of the procedure, but also lessens the level of performance, could result in wear on the part, plus there is furthermore an evident heating of the material being worked on, an outcome of friction. With thinner objects, it's elevated heat (and a relating flexibility of the metal) which can cause elements to bend, flex or twist. Commonly, it will require a competent polisher to take into account every one of these elements to both not cause harm to the workpiece and to perform the work correctly. In order to appreciably increase the quality of the resulting surface, the polishing process has to be completed with considerably less vigour and not as much force so that you may in the end produce a surface devoid of scratches or marks due to the the polishing procedure, thereby arriving at a smooth mirror finish.
